Name the 5 HEALTH RELATED FITNESS COMPONENTS:
1. Aerobic Fitness
2. Muscular Endurance
3. Muscular Strength
4. Flexibility
5. Body Composition
Read the definitions of the SKILL RELATED FITNESS COMPONENTS and give 2 activity examples of each.
*There are many different answers that would be correct for all of these, but here are a few examples*
Speedis the ability to move a body part quickly.
1. Track and Field
2. Speed Skating
Reaction Time is how quickly your brain can respond to a stimulus (like the word “GO”) and initiate a response.
1. Swimming
2. Track and Field
Agilityis being able to change your direction and the speed at which you are traveling quickly and efficiently.
1. Gymnastics
2. Football
Balanceis the ability to maintain equilibrium while stationary or moving.
1. Gymnastics
2. Springboard Diving
Coordinationis the ability to use your body and your senses together to produce smooth efficient movements.

Poweris the product of strength and speed and is being able to perform a task as quickly and as forcefully as we can.
1. Weight Lifting
2. football

What are 3 examples of "lean body mass"?
1. Bone
2. Muscle
3. Organs
4. Body Fluids
What are 3 of the benefits of fat in your body?
1. Acts as an insulator, helping the body adapt to heat and cold
2. Acts as a shock absorber, helping to protect internal organs and bones from injury.
3. Helps the body use vitamins effectively
4. Acts as storage energy when the body needs energy
5. Maintains healthy skin and hair
6. Regulates levels of cholesterol in the blood.
How do you think a person's body composition is tested?
~ Body Composition is measured by calculating a person’s Body Mass Index (or BMI). Elementary students’ body composition is constantly changing due to rapid growth spurts, so children have a different BMI calculation table than adults. Definitions:
Muscular strength is the ability of the muscles to lift weight. Muscular strength is an anaerobic mechanism which means that it does not require oxygen.
Muscular endurance is the ability of a muscle or group of muscles to sustain repeated contractions against a resistance for an extended period of time. Muscular endurance is an aerobic mechanism which means that it requires oxygen as an energy source.
